Why Gobindo Bhog Rice Works Well for Bulk Buying Gobindobhog is a short grain aromatic rice from the Damodar belt of Purba Bardhaman, West Bengal. It has a Geographical Indication, or GI tag, because the GI belt has the soil and climate that create its recognised fragrance. Gobindabhog and Tulaipanji received registration as premium traditional aromatic rices of West Bengal in October 2017. The GI tag matters in trade because the name has a legal origin. Gobindo Bhog Rice Price in Assam: 2026 Wholesale Rates The Gobindo Bhog rice price in Assam depends on crop age, bag size, order volume, and freight. The wholesale price usually falls between ₹120 and ₹190 per kg. Guwahati often sits at the higher end because transport from Bengal adds to the landed rate. Do not compare marketplace retail packs with wholesale rates. Compare bag rates with bag rates. Pack size Best for Indicative wholesale price 1 kg and 5 kg packs Households, festive use, gifting ₹150 to ₹190 per kg 10 kg pack Tea stalls and small caterers ₹145 to ₹180 per kg 25 kg bag / 26 kg PP bag Restaurants, kirana and hotel kitchens ₹140 to ₹175 per kg 30 kg sack / 50 kg sack Distributors and bulk buyers ₹120 to ₹155 per kg Volume slabs matter more than long bargaining. A 100 kg bulk order and a 1,000 kg order should not carry the same rate. If a rice supplier in Assam offers one flat price for every quantity, they may be quoting a retail rate as wholesale. Bag Sizes, MOQ and Storage Minimum order quantity can look confusing because MOQ ranges from 5 kg to 25 metric tonnes across the market. Start with your monthly usage, not the supplier’s preferred quantity. Restaurants and caterers usually choose a 25 kg bag or 26 kg PP bag because it stacks well and finishes before the aroma weakens. A kirana or grocery counter can combine 1 kg and 5 kg packs with a larger bag for loose sale. Distributors should discuss 30 kg sack and 50 kg sack pricing from 500 kg upward. A jute bag breathes better in Assam humidity. HDPE and PP bag packaging handles transport better. Choose the material based on storage conditions. DOUBLE D.P. Quality Specs to Confirm Before Payment A dependable gobindobhog rice manufacturer puts the following details in writing. Spec Standard to request Why it matters Admixture 2% or lower Reduces the risk of cheaper grain mixed in Broken 1% maximum Helps prevent sticky rice Moisture 13% to 14% maximum Protects the weight and shelf life Purity 99% and above Confirms a single variety Shelf life 12 months or 2 years Helps identify aged stock Cultivation type Common or organic stated clearly Keeps pricing honest Country of origin West Bengal, India Supports the GI claim Check GST and FSSAI details before the first consignment, not after a dispute. Joha or Gobindo Bhog? Know the Difference Joha rice of Assam has its own GI under Certificate No. 287, issued on 27 April 2017 to Assam Agricultural University and Seuj Satirtha. Joha is Assamese. Gobindobhog is Bengali. They are both aromatic, but they are not the same rice. Supply shortages sometimes lead sellers to place different short-grain varieties under one familiar name. You may also see Sona Chur, Chitti Muthyalu, Kaima, Jeerakasala rice, or Jeerasambha rice. Some may offer a similar eating experience, while others are separate varieties. When you buy gobindo bhog rice in assam online wholesale, ensure the name on the bag matches the variety inside it. Sourcing premium rice from Eastern India comes down to five checks: verified milling infrastructure, moisture content below 14%, adequate stock aging, transit-grade packaging, and commercial terms settled in writing. The region, centred on West Bengal, grows short-grain aromatic varieties such as Gobindobhog alongside staples like Miniket and Baskati, which is why wholesalers shortlisting a rice supplier in India often start here. This guide covers each check in order. Why do wholesalers source rice from Eastern India? West Bengal is consistently among India’s largest rice-producing states, and its Gangetic alluvial soil supports aromatic varieties that are difficult to grow elsewhere. Gobindobhog, the region’s signature short-grain aromatic rice, is registered as a Geographical Indication (GI No. 531), with cultivation concentrated in districts such as Purba Bardhaman. For a wholesaler this matters in demand terms. Short-grain aromatic rice serves festival cooking, Bengali sweets such as payesh, temple bhog, and regional short-grain biryani styles. Long-grain staples do not cover those segments. Sourcing close to the growing belt also shortens the chain between farm, mill and warehouse, which reduces handling and blending risk. Which rice varieties should wholesalers source from this region? Three varieties carry most of the wholesale demand from Eastern India. Gobindobhog – A short-grain, white, aromatic rice with a naturally sweet, buttery flavour. It is used in Bengali festival cooking, payesh and bhog, and in short-grain biryani formats. Aged stock develops a stronger aroma and cooks less sticky, so always ask for the harvest year and how long the lot has been held. Miniket – A slender long-grain white rice for everyday meals. It is light, digests easily and moves in high volumes, which makes it a dependable base SKU for retail and hotel supply. Baskati – A long-grain variety that stays separate and non-sticky after cooking, which suits biryani and fried rice preparation at volume. How do you verify quality before a bulk order? Test a sample from the exact lot you intend to buy, not a showcase sample. Check three things. First, moisture: it should be below 14% for safe storage. Anything higher risks mold and insect activity in transit and warehousing. Second, uniformity: mills running colour sortex lines deliver grain free of broken kernels, stones and discoloured grains, so ask whether sorting happens in-house. Third, age: freshly harvested aromatic rice has not yet developed its full aroma or cooking texture, so confirm the crop year and the aging period of the stock on offer. Alongside the physical checks, ask for the mill’s FSSAI licence number and batch test reports where available. A supplier that documents its lots is easier to hold to a specification later. What packaging protects bulk rice in transit? Rice absorbs ambient moisture, so packaging is a quality decision before it is a branding one. PP (polypropylene) bags give standard moisture protection at volume. BOPP bags add print quality and durability for retail-facing stock. Jute suits traditional markets and breathable storage, particularly where buyers repack locally. Match the bag to the humidity of the destination market, not just the price sheet. Which commercial terms should you settle before ordering? Put minimum order quantity, credit terms, delivery timelines and the dispute process in writing before the first consignment. Confirm MOQ per variety rather than per order, since aromatic and staple lines often carry different thresholds. Agree who bears transit risk and how shortages or damaged bags are compensated. Clear terms cost nothing upfront; unclear terms surface as disputes during festival-season peaks, exactly when replacement stock is hardest to arrange. Which sourcing mistakes cost wholesalers money? Chasing the lowest quoted price is the most expensive habit in rice sourcing. Unusually cheap lots often signal older stock blended with broken or low-grade grain. Ignoring the crop year is the second mistake: aroma and texture depend on aging, and a fresh lot sold as aged stock will underperform in the kitchen. The third is skipping the sample stage. A bulk order placed on a photograph is a bulk problem waiting to arrive. Selling rice in 1kg to 5kg packs usually earns a retailer a better profit margin than selling the same rice loose from 25kg or 50kg sacks. Smaller premium packs support higher per-kilogram pricing, they cut spillage and spoilage, and they turn over faster among the smaller households that now dominate urban buying. For a specialty grain like Gobindobhog rice, the effect is larger still, because shoppers already treat it as a premium purchase rather than a daily commodity. Here is what actually drives the margin difference, and why aromatic rice sits at the top of the list. Why do smaller packs earn a higher margin than loose sacks? A sealed 1kg or 2kg pouch signals hygiene, and shoppers pay for that signal. Rice sold loose from an open sack invites dust, moisture, and pests, so it reads as a low-value commodity and forces you to compete on price alone. A clean, sealed, labelled pack lets you position the same grain as a quality product and hold a firmer retail price. The gap between your bulk buying rate and that shelf price is your margin, and packaging is what widens it. Packaging also carries the information a premium shopper checks before buying: variety, net weight, and packing details. India’s food-labelling rules under the Food Safety and Standards Authority of India require this on packaged food, so a compliant pack does double duty. It builds buyer trust and keeps your store on the right side of regulation. How does packaging reduce a retailer’s losses? Loose rice leaks money. Every scoop spills a little, the top layer draws moisture, and the bottom of a long-standing sack attracts pests. In retail, spilled and spoiled rice is spilled and spoiled cash. Airtight 1kg to 5kg packs remove almost all of that: no scooping loss, longer shelf life, and stock you can count in seconds during inventory. Lower shrinkage means more of what you buy actually reaches the till as revenue. Smaller packs also match how families shop today. Fewer households buy 50kg sacks now; urban buyers want 1kg, 2kg, or 5kg sizes that fit a kitchen shelf and a weekly budget. Smaller units sell more often, which speeds up your stock rotation and your return on each purchase. A shopper who finishes a 2kg pack in a fortnight returns twice as often as one working through a 25kg sack. Why is Gobindobhog rice a high-margin product for shops? Gobindobhog is a short-grain aromatic rice native to the Bardhaman region of West Bengal, and it carries a Geographical Indication tag, GI registration No. 531, which legally reserves the name for rice of that variety and origin. That protected status is exactly why it commands a premium. Buyers associate the name with a specific aroma, a buttery taste, and genuine provenance, not with generic white rice. Common milled rice competes on volume and thin margins. A specialty aromatic rice does not. People buy Gobindobhog for festivals, pujas, biryani, ghee rice, and payasam, and they accept a higher price for it. That demand is now growing well beyond Bengal into Kerala, Tamil Nadu, and Karnataka, and export interest is rising too, supported by the quality-grading and export facilitation offered through APEDA. For a retailer, stocking a recognised aromatic variety in neat retail packs turns a basic staple into a high-value line that does not sit on the shelf. Feature of packaged rice Impact on retailer margin Sealed, labelled packs Supports higher shelf pricing Airtight 1kg-5kg sizes Near-zero spillage and spoilage Smaller pack sizes Faster turnover, quicker ROI Specialty aromatic variety Premium pricing vs commodity rice The bottom line Moving your rice from loose sacks to 1kg-5kg premium packs improves retail margins on three fronts at once. You can charge more for a clean, labelled product. You lose far less stock to spillage and spoilage. And you sell faster to the small households that drive most urban rice buying. With a specialty grain like Gobindobhog, every one of those effects is amplified, because the variety already carries premium expectations and protected-origin credibility. Instead of fighting for paise on loose commodity rice, you are selling a retail-ready product that customers reach for without hesitation. If you are planning your shelves for the coming year, small-pack aromatic rice is one of the simplest margin upgrades available to a grocery store or supermarket. Gobindo bhog rice’s signature aroma comes from 2-acetyl-1-pyrroline (2-AP), a naturally occurring aroma compound also found in popcorn and fresh bread. The compound forms most strongly in Gobindo bhog because of its specific growing region — Purba Bardhaman district, West Bengal — combined with proper post-harvest aging and low-heat milling, both of which are required to keep the compound from degrading before the rice reaches the consumer. What Compound Causes the Aroma in Gobindo bhog Rice? The aroma compound is 2-acetyl-1-pyrroline (2-AP), discovered in 1982 by Buttery and co-workers, who identified it as the principal compound imparting the pleasant aroma to basmati and other scented rice varieties. It is described as a popcorn-like aroma compound and is also present in pandan leaf and popcorn. 2-AP is chemically unstable. Pure 2-AP degrades within about 10 minutes at room temperature, which is why handling after harvest — not just the rice variety itself — determines whether the aroma survives to the consumer. Why Is Gobindo bhog Rice More Aromatic Than Other Rice Varieties? Three factors compound on top of the genetics: Is Gobindo bhog a Legally Protected Rice Variety? Yes. Gobindo bhog holds Geographical Indication (GI) registration No. 531 in India. The application was filed by the State Government of West Bengal in August 2015, and as a result of the GI tag, rice from other regions or other varieties cannot legally be branded as “Gobindo bhog”. This means the name itself is a sourcing guarantee, not a marketing term — comparable to Darjeeling tea or Champagne in how the law treats it. Does Aging Rice After Harvest Increase Its Aroma? Yes, within limits. Freshly harvested Gobindo bhog paddy is not at peak aroma. Controlled aging reduces internal grain moisture and stabilizes aromatic oils that would otherwise dissipate. Under-aged rice loses fragrance; rice aged too long in poor storage conditions goes stale. The aging window is a quality variable that differs between producers — it is not standardized across the category. Why Does Milling Temperature Affect Rice Aroma? Because 2-AP degrades rapidly at room temperature, and high-friction milling generates heat well above that threshold. Milling that runs too hot or too fast can destroy aroma compounds that months of proper aging worked to concentrate. This is a documented mechanism, not a brand claim — it follows directly from 2-AP’s known instability. FAQs

Let us explore how mother nature shapes this exquisite grain. The Right Soil: The Foundation of Taste The quality of Gobindo Bhog rice depends heavily on where it is grown. This grain thrives beautifully in the fertile plains of West Bengal, particularly in the Burdwan district, which is proudly known as the “rice bowl” of the region.  The soil here is alluvial soil, which means it is rich in organic matter and natural nutrients washed down by the river systems. This unique soil behaves like a natural sponge. It holds onto water just long enough to give the rice crops steady nourishment without drowning the roots. The minerals present in this alluvial soil are exactly what give the rice its signature sweet, buttery flavor profile. Because this soil cannot be replicated easily anywhere else, special gobindo bhog rice manufacturers in india focus heavily on sourcing their paddy directly from these geographical zones to keep the taste authentic.  The Ideal Climate: Crafting the Sweet Aroma If soil gives the rice its taste, the climate gives it that unmistakable, mouth-watering fragrance. Gobindo Bhog is a unique crop because it is traditionally cultivated a bit later in the season, mostly during the Kharif (monsoon) season, stretching into the cooler months. This specific weather cycle ensures that when you open a bag of rice packed by EIRM, the natural perfume fills your kitchen instantly. Water and Natural Protection Because Gobindo Bhog is planted slightly later than standard rice varieties, it escapes the harsh, heavy downpours of the early monsoon that often damage younger crops. The gentle, residual moisture left in the soil and air is just right. Additionally, this late-timed climate naturally protects the crop. The cooler weather patterns mean fewer pests and insects attack the fields. Farmers do not need to rely on heavy chemicals or artificial pesticides. This allows the rice to grow naturally, maintaining its pure, clean, and healthy properties.
